In CT imaging, what is measured are projections of a 3D object, and the goal is to reconstruct the object from these projections.

Conformal geometric algebra, which extends to five-dimensional space, allows for the representation of points, lines, planes, and spheres as algebraic objects, simplifying many geometric operations.

In my postdoc, I shifted towards inverse imaging problems, where the observed data is not a direct image but a transform, such as in CT scans.
